Are you a passionate and proactive HR professional looking to make a real impact? Aneurin Leisure Trust is seeking a dynamic Human Resources Business Partner to join our team on a fixed-term basis to cover maternity leave.

In this pivotal role, you’ll work closely with managers across the Trust to deliver a comprehensive HR service that champions best practice, supports employee wellbeing, and drives organisational development. From managing employee relations and supporting recruitment to coaching managers and overseeing learning and development, your work will help shape a positive and inclusive workplace culture.

What You’ll Be Doing:

  • Acting as the first point of contact for HR queries and managing the HR mailbox

  • Supporting the full employee lifecycle, including recruitment, onboarding, and changes to terms

  • Leading on attendance management and supporting wellbeing initiatives

  • Coaching and advising managers on HR policies and complex employee relations issues

  • Coordinating training and development, including HR toolkits for managers

  • Maintaining accurate HR records and ensuring GDPR compliance

What We’re Looking For:

  • CIPD Level 5 (or equivalent) – Essential

  • Strong knowledge of employment law and HR best practices

  • Excellent communication and organisational skills

  • Experience in HR systems (e.g., iTrent, Planday) – Desirable

  • A proactive, supportive, and solutions-focused approach

  • A full driving licence and access to a vehicle
